The rapidly evolving workforce landscape is witnessing a transformative shift as contingent workers increasingly become a vital component of organizational talent strategies. Over the next decade, these non-permanent workers, including freelancers, gig workers, and contractors, are predicted to surpass the number of full-time employees, prompting a need for comprehensive management solutions. Addressing this significant change, Deloitte has launched its Extended Workforce Solutions (EWS) to provide organizations a strategic framework for effectively integrating contingent talent. This initiative focuses on blending diverse worker profiles into unified workforce strategies, embracing technological advancements and partnerships to achieve organizational efficiency and agility.
